Bachelor of Arts, Major in Art, Concentration in Studio Art (42 credit hours):

The Bachelor of Art, Major in Art degree with a concentration in Studio Art allows a student to pursue a major in art while balancing her art education with a broader liberal arts background. Students develop an impressive portfolio and exhibit their work every semester in the Moreau Art Galleries. Students work closely with accomplished professors who exhibit regionally, nationally, and internationally and explore new developments in art and a wide range of media and techniques.

Major Core Requirements:

Drawing I and II (ART 101 and ART 102)

2D and 3D Design (ART 103 and ART 104)

Art History Survey I and II (ART 241 and ART 242) -or-

Italian Art History I and II taken in Rome (ART 251RM or 252RM)

Major Elective Requirements:

One additional upper-level art history course

Six additional studio elective courses, 4 in an Area of Emphasis

Senior Comprehensive requirement

Participation in eight Portfolio Reviews

Advanced W portfolio

Please take note that there are additional general education requirements that make up the full B.A. degree. Additional information about the full requirements can be found in the Art Majors Handbook and the Saint Mary's College Bulletin.
